What is the character of the Taabinga locality where the property is situated?
Taabinga is a rural town in the South Burnett Region of Queensland, known for its quiet countryside atmosphere. In the 2021 census the locality recorded a population of 601 people.
What is the historical origin of the name ‘Taabinga’?
The town takes its name from the Taabinga pastoral run occupied by Charles Robert Haly around 1849. The name derives from the Waka language word ‘dha‑bengga’, meaning “place of jumper ants.”
